Which are the main factors which influence the location of an industry?

Market, transport, capital, power, labour, water, land, availability of raw material are the most important factors which influence the location of industries.

  • The place where all the above factors are available with ease is the location where industries are located.
  • Industrialisation often leads to growth and development of towns and cities.
  • To attract industries in backward areas, the governments tend to provide incentives such as better infrastructure, lower transportation costs, subsidised power etc.
  • When industries are located close to each other and share the benefits of their proximity, then it leads to emergence of industrial regions.
  • Major industrial regions of the world are eastern Asia, eastern Europe, central Europe, western Europe, eastern North America.
  • There is a tendency to locate large industrial regions near coal fields, near sea ports, and are located in temperate regions.
  • India has major industrial regions such as Gurgaon-Delhi-Meerut region, Chota Nagpur industrial belt, Bangalore-Tamil Nadu region, Vishakhapatnam-Guntur belt, Hugli region, Mumbai-Pune cluster, Ahmedabad-Baroda region.
  • The nations where steel and iron industries are concentrated are Russia, China, Japan, Germany, USA.
  • Taiwan, South Korea, Japan, India, Hong Kong are the countries where textile industries are concentrated.
  • The major hubs of the Information technology industry are Bangalore region of India and Silicon valley of Central California.
